Judge Slashes Delphi Executive Bonuses by 80 Percent

Responding to objections by IUE-CWA and the Auto Workers to Delphi's proposed management compensation plan, bankruptcy Judge Robert Drain drastically slashed Delphi's proposed $87 million in cash bonuses for executives to $16.5 million.

"After so much sacrifice by Delphi's frontline workers, it is gratifying that the judge recognized the overwhelming greed in throwing huge cash payments to Delphi's executives," said IUE-CWA President Jim Clark.  "It is a very symbolic victory for our members.  Fairness prevails with this decision."

Recognizing that Delphi's workers have suffered greatly in the company's restructuring, Judge Drain established the amount for the award to executives to require some "equivalence of sacrifice."  It was the largest reduction in proposed executive compensation ever imposed by a bankruptcy court, said IUE-CWA's attorney Tom Kennedy.
